    Friedrich Freek GmbH is a family-run company based in Germany. We develop, produce and sell electrical heating elements. As a globally recognised process heating specialist, we have been supplying reliable high-quality products proudly made in Germany from a single source since 1950. Freek supplies its heating elements to renowned companies across a variety of sectors. The manufacturing of highly innovative HotMicroCoils, often employed as nozzle heating elements for hotrunners in plastic injection moulding, is one of our most significant business areas today. However, our customers also benefit from our wide product assortment, which includes all types of industrial heating elements. In addition to the HotMicroCoils, we also supply: Tubular heating elements, heating cartridges, infrared heaters, surface and film heating elements, heating elements for air heaters as well as the accompanying measurement and control technology for this. Thanks to intelligent value creation, innovative production concepts and a wealth of expertise, Freek is able to serve more than 1000 customers each year

    Our production range of slightly viscous to paste products is currently available in sachets from 5–15 g, 5 ml aluminium tubes, small and large 60/150/310 ml cartridges and foil pouches from 300 to 600 ml. We manufacture, fill and package liquid chemical/technical products in a range of aluminium and plastic bottles, drums, canisters and steel containers from a minimum volume of 5 ml up to 100, 250, 500, 1000 and 1500 ml, and in large containers from 20, 30, 60 or 200 l up to 1000 l. We also manufacture products in all our ranges under customer labels for industry, trade and commerce. RWC catering industry lamps: Decorative table lamps and accessories, paraffin lamp oil for the catering industry in 13 colours.

    History of APE Engineering GmbH Company building APE Engineering GmbH. APE Engineering GmbH's route from one-man-enterprise to thriving medium-sized company with an annual turnover of roughly 2 million euros. Dipl.-Ing. Andreas Prasuhn's immediate idea on founding his company in 1989 – a barrel lifting truck for 200 l channel drums – was in the spirit of the times. This now nostalgic barrel lifting truck was the foundation of the APE modular system. Reduced workload for employees in workshops and production facilities in all industries. The range of machines on offer covers manageable barrels, drainage barrels, castors, containers and bulky goods right through to the nuclear industry, where humans should no longer come in contact with radiation. APE occupational safety objective: Taking heavy loads away from humans, through to monotonous work that can be automated. For example, emptying bags, draining barrels and emission protection in particular.
